3. Preparation
3.4. Calibrating the transmitter

5. Apply the lower pressure to the meter body. When applying a negative pressure the high side of
the meter body will be at a lower pressure than the low side.
6. Select the Cal Lower command and wait for the calibration status value to change from NONE to
SUCCESS, SUCCESS with EXCESS, of FAILURE. If the status returns FAILURE stop and
check that the value of the lower calibration point is within the range of the meter body.
7. Apply the upper pressure to the meter body. As with the lower pressure value, when applying a
negative pressure the high side of the meter body will be at a lower pressure than the low side.
8. Select the Cal Upper command and wait for the calibration status value to change from NONE to
SUCCESS, SUCCESS with EXCESS, of FAILURE. If the status returns FAILURE stop and
check that the value of the upper calibration point is within the range of the meter body. If the
status returns SUCCESS with EXCESS the calibration was applied but the adjusted
characterization value is outside it’s allowed adjustment range and the accuracy of the process
value over the calibrated range is not guaranteed to be within the specified tolerance.
Note: When applying pressure, insure the pressure is stable in order to get a valid setting. Some pressure
sources can vary in pressure (bounce especially dead weight testers) and this will give false reading.
Notes on Calibration Status:
SUCCESS: If the calibration status return SUCCESS it is indicating that the transmitter successfully
applied a gain and offset that provides a process value that is within the specified accuracy over the
calibrated range of .075% of the reduce range or ±0.025 + 0.05 20 psi span psi or ±0.025 + 0.05 ( 1.4 bar
)span bar in % span.
FAILURE: If the calibration status returns FAILURE it is indicating that the transmitter could not be
calibrated either due to the calibration points being beyond the range of the meter body or the calibration
span (difference between the upper and lower calibration points) is too small.
SUCCESSS with EXCESS: If the calibration status returns SUCCESS with EXCESS it is indicating that
the calibration was successful but the applied gain or offset resulting from the calibration is deviates by
more than 5% of the characterized range. This could happen if the applied calibration pressure for either
the upper or lower calibration point deviates from the selected calibration point in a manner that will cause
the adjusted gain or zero correction be greater than 5% of the URL.
